WHO denounces the destruction of the health system in Gaza

Since October, Israel’s army has again taken massive action against Hamas in the north of the Gaza Strip. Now a hospital is the target of the offensive again.
The World Health Organization (WHO) has denounced the Israeli army’s “systematic dismantling” of the health system in the Gaza Strip. This is a death sentence for tens of thousands of Palestinians who need medical care. The Israeli military shut down the Kamal Adwan Hospital during an operation. The UN organization complained that it was the last major health facility in the north of the coastal strip.
Initial reports said several important departments in the hospital were destroyed by fire during the attack. There are still 60 employees and 25 patients in critical condition in the hospital, including those on ventilators. All other patients were forced to go to the Indonesian hospital, which was also no longer functional.
Israel’s army said it had begun an operation in the Kamal Adwan Hospital in the morning. It serves as a stronghold for Hamas terrorists in northern Gaza, who use the hospital for military purposes and as a hideout, it said in a statement.
Israel’s army emphasized that it was protecting civilians, patients and clinic employees. The people were evacuated before the operation in cooperation with local employees of the health authorities and international organizations. The military emphasized that the army was acting in accordance with international law.
The information provided by both sides could not initially be independently verified. Israel’s military has already been deployed to clinics in the Gaza Strip several times because it accuses Hamas of using them for its own purposes.
